CVE-2009-0111 describes a SQL injection vulnerability in Goople CMS version 1.8.2 and earlier, specifically within the frontpage.php script. This flaw allows unauthenticated remote attackers to execute arbitrary SQL commands by manipulating the 'username' parameter. With a CVSS score of 7.5, this vulnerability is considered highly severe, enabling full compromise of confidentiality, integrity, and availability. While not actively exploited in the wild or on the KEV catalog, public exploit code exists on ExploitDB, and there is no significant community discussion or media coverage surrounding it.
